Box Score (WILSON, N.C.) – A masterful Mitch Sorensen (R-Jr., Westlake, Ohio/Avon) and a powerful top half of the lineup helped Lake Erie even up the season with an 11-1 victory over Saint Rose at Fleming Stadium on Sunday. Sorensen mowed down the Golden Knights with 11 strikeouts while the Storm's one through five batters combined for eight of the team's 11 hits and nine RBI's.
The scoring came fast and furious as Lake Erie (2-2-1) jumped out to an 8-0 lead after two frames thanks to a six-spot in the second. Nathan Birtley (Jr., Mentor, Ohio / Mentor) highlighted the second with a two-run home run that also scored Scott Fernald (Jr., San Jose, Calif. / St. Francis). Later in the inning with the bases loaded, Sam Browning (Sr., Cincinnati, Ohio / Archbishop McNicholas) cleared them all with a double to plate Trace Peterson (Jr., Brunswick, Ohio / Medina), Reed Collins (Jr., Farmington, Minn. / Farmington), and Corbin Paxton (Sr., Sylvania, Ohio / Sylvania-Northview).
While the six runs definitely provided a cushion, Sorensen only needed the two in the first. His first strike out didn't come until the second inning, but the Golden Knights quickly went down fast with three punch outs of the swinging-and-miss variety.
Sorensen went on to have multiple strikeouts in the fourth and sixth innings as well. The only run scored against him came in the seventh inning on a sac fly. Overall he allowed just six hits in the complete game.
Birtley, Paxton, Collins, and Brady Minetti (Sr., McKees Rocks, Pa. / Montour) all had multiple-hit games to lead the offense. Collins, Peterson, Browning, and Minetti all had extra-base hits in addition to Birtley's round trip. Paxton, Collins, Peterson, and Fernald all scored twice for the Storm as well.
